Transaction 818597f68ac35a1e76588800ac33c07296bea7f32fa5b5e7ef9c52c45ffca842
1 Input
1 Output
-
818597f68ac35a1e76588800ac33c07296bea7f32fa5b5e7ef9c52c45ffca842:0
- value
- 139156970
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f15b48f4a3ce309aca6fe6fbd8dbbaee587458a
- address
- bc1q9u2mfr628n3snt9xlehmmrdm4mjcw3v2yxjn3v